spotDL v4
spotDL finds songs from Spotify playlists on YouTube and downloads them - along with album art, lyrics and metadata.

Installation
Refer to our Installation Guide for more details.
Python (Recommended Method)
- _spotDL_ can be installed by running pip install spotdl.
- To update spotDL run pip install --upgrade spotdl
> On some systems you might have to change pip to pip3.

Installing FFmpeg
FFmpeg is required for spotDL. If using FFmpeg only for spotDL, you can simply install FFmpeg to your spotDL installation directory:spotdl --download-ffmpeg
We recommend the above option, but if you want to install FFmpeg system-wide,
follow these instructions
- Windows Tutorial
- OSX - brew install ffmpeg
- Linux - sudo apt install ffmpeg or use your distro's package manager
Usage
Using SpotDL without options:
spotdl [urls]You can run _spotDL_ as a package if running it as a script doesn't work:
python -m spotdl [urls]General usage:
spotdl [operation] [options] QUERYThere are different operations spotDL can perform. The _default_ is download, which simply downloads the songs from YouTube and embeds metadata.
The query for spotDL is usually a list of Spotify URLs, but for some operations like sync, only a single link or file is required.
For a list of all options use ``spotdl -h`
<details>
<summary style="font-size:1em"><strong>Supported operations</strong></summary>
- save: Saves only the metadata from Spotify without downloading anything.spotdl save [query] --save-file {filename}.spotdl
- Usage:
- web: Starts a web interface instead of using the command line. However, it has limited features and only supports downloading individual songs.
- url: Get user-friendly URL for each song from the query.spotdl url [query]
- Usage:
- sync: Updates directories. Compares the directory with the current state of the playlist. Newly added songs will be downloaded and removed songs will be deleted. No other songs will be downloaded and no other files will be deleted.
- Usage:
spotdl sync [query] --save-file {filename}.spotdl
This creates a new sync file. To update the directory in the future, use:
spotdl sync {filename}.spotdl
- meta`: Updates metadata for the provided song files.

Music Sourcing and Audio Quality
spotDL uses YouTube as a source for music downloads. This method is used to avoid any issues related to downloading music from Spotify.
Note
Users are responsible for their actions and potential legal consequences. We do not support unauthorized downloading of copyrighted material and take no responsibility for user actions.
Audio Quality
spotDL downloads music from YouTube and is designed to always download the highest possible bitrate; which is 128 kbps for regular users and 256 kbps for YouTube Music premium users.
